Music Man is just telling the way to copy or move notes or phrases of a style part to a different beat of that style part.
E.g a guitar strumming that was starting at beat 1(downbeat) now is moved to start at the beat 1 1/2(upbeat).
Same thing can be done with a midi pad musical phrase.
Why this is good and not re-write a new phrase at the point you want it?
Because probably you will mess up the chords and it will not sound correctly.

You got it exactly right. Some phrases have a magic that can only be achieved by a combination of subtle elements in the midi performance:
The duration of notes
The timing (slight imperfections often create a great feel)
The velocity (can produce timbrel changes or trigger various articulations)
The Voicing (for chords)
The choice of notes
The melodic idea
The Voice preset that is used
The effects
Automation (of panning, volume, effects parameters etc)
The SFF parameters
I've found many amazing phrases that i would like to use in professional music productions. With the ability to adapt the start time of phrases, it gives me many more options for how phrases can be used.

By the using the technique of copying parts of style phrases in Step Edit > Multi Select, you can pick out great little snippets of patterns, riffs, guitar strumming etc within a single style part and then copy those "phrases" to any point in the time line. This will enable you to make many variations of a riff, melody, strum without having to try to recreate it from scratch which might be very difficult considering interplay of so many elements.
... and if you DO create your own styles, you can reuse your own phrases in many more ways by the ability to copy continuous snippets of you phrases to any beat or upbeat in the time line.
One of the most difficult aspects of music production is the micro editing of midi to make it sound great.
I have spend literally days working on phrases, manipulating all the elements mentioned above and eventually is ends up sounding great. Now with Genos, I can put that amount of work in, but now i have the ability to reuse my work in many ways. ... and copying snippets of phrases to different starting points extends the possibilities even more.
